FAQ for Vehicle Speed Sensors Repair

Q: What's the installation procedure for the input speed sensor?
A:
The installation procedure is to install the input speed sensor and the input speed sensor bolt, connect the electrical wiring harness connector to the input speed sensor, then install the transmission fluid pan and filter.

Q: What's the installation procedure for the output speed sensor?
A:
The installation procedure is to install the output speed sensor spacer, the output speed sensor, and the output speed sensor bolt, connect the electrical wiring harness connector to the output speed sensor, then install the transmission fluid pan and filter.

Q: What's the recommended torque for the output speed sensor bolt?
A:
The recommended torque is 11 N.m (97-inch lbs.).

Q: What's the recommended torque for the input speed sensor bolt?
A:
The recommended torque is 11 N.m (97-inch lbs.).
